RoboTTT Extends Robot Memory to 5 Minutes
seanmcdonaldxyz · x · 2026-07-16
This reply introduces RoboTTT: a robotic policy that embeds test-time training (TTT) directly inside the model.
Key points include:
- Robotic models typically remember only extremely short time slices (under 0.1 seconds), forgetting immediate events almost instantly.
- RoboTTT expands the context to 8,000 timesteps, equivalent to roughly 5 minutes of "muscle memory."
- The author states this is achieved at a constant inference cost, outperforming current SOTA capabilities by 3 orders of magnitude.
- The core concept involves having a tiny model "live" inside a larger model, continuously updating as it processes each new input.
